Objective / Project Overview
The ES team will provide comprehensive mechanical design support to project DRIs
Within The EMC Design Engineering Team. Key Responsibilities Include
- Designing and validating mechanical parts, e.g. fixtures and tools, for EMC
automation systems. Supporting system bringup, debugging issues and
implementing robust solutions.
- Collaborating with EMC Design DRIs to develop system mock-ups.
- Collaborating with EMC Test Engineers for test system development & deployment
- Supporting EMC Technologists for CAD preparation.
- Work with our team to pick a supplier and order parts.
- Documenting best practices, SOPs and maintaining a library of proven designs.
Requirements
Location must be SCV area, in-person work 5 days per week is required.
Skills
- Minimum
- BS in Mechanical Engineering or equivalent with a 2+ years of experience.
- The ability to perform mechanical design & validation, including the development
of component or material evaluation tests, and failure analysis.
- Expert in using 3D CAD software to design parts with complex geometry
- Exposure to diverse manufacturing techniques such as CNC, 3D printing, sheet-
metal stamping, and materials such as polymers, glass, and metals. Good
understanding of DFA/DFM, and statistical tolerance analysis.
- Ability to write and maintain clean documentation for design processes.
- Desired
- Experienced with electromechanical integration, such as sensors, motors, motor
drivers, wire harnesses, and communication buses.
- Experienced with simulation and analysis methodology (FEA, MATLAB etc.)
- High energy personality with a real passion for learning and attention to detail.
